Summary

Council approved its consent calendar—covering licenses, a snow removal bid date, event and lottery notices—and read a proclamation declaring September as Library Card Sign-Up Month.

The council approved its consent calendar, which included multiple routine items and a proclamation.

The consent calendar covered a day care license with a zoning special exception (Nicole Fuller), a day care license renewal, a set bid date for snow removal services, a community event permit for the Dakota Prairie Museum’s Harvest Stroll festival on Sept. 27, and lottery notices for the Dakota Prairie Museum and the YMCA. City staff clarified that the daycare request “went through the normal special exception process through the board of zoning adjustment.”

Council moved and seconded approval of the consent calendar and approved it by voice vote.

Separately, the council read and adopted a proclamation declaring September 2025 as Library Card Sign-Up Month in Aberdeen. Anna Lilly Moser, identified in the meeting as the library director, described library programming and encouraged residents to sign up for library cards during the month.
